Cinematic Slideshow Studio turns a collection of photos and videos into a polished visual story without requiring the user to spend hours learning a complicated editor. Instead of treating every image as a separate slide, the platform looks at the story behind the media and helps arrange scenes, timing, transitions, music, and narration into a cohesive presentation.
The idea is particularly appealing for moments that deserve more than a basic photo montage. Weddings, memorials, birthdays, anniversaries, travel memories, family stories, real estate presentations, and business pitches can all benefit from a more deliberate visual flow. Users can upload between 20 and 200 photos and videos in formats such as JPG, PNG, HEIC, and MP4, then let the AI handle much of the initial composition.

The platform's AI features are focused less on generating completely new media and more on understanding and arranging the media a user already has. Its vision-based photo analysis identifies subjects and faces to improve cropping, while script analysis looks for topics, tone, and potential story structure.
The composition system uses topic scenes for important story moments and filler scenes to maintain rhythm between them. This approach is useful when a project contains a large number of photos but only a handful of images are central to the story.
The service states that a project can move from upload to export in under ten minutes, depending on the workflow. Export options range from 720p on the free plan to 1080p and 4K on Pro, with frame rates of up to 60 fps available on the paid tier.
One of the strongest aspects of the platform is the way several normally separate editing tasks are connected. A user can provide a story, have the system analyze it, arrange relevant scenes, select suitable pacing, create narration, and synchronize the resulting presentation with music.
The AI voice narration feature can turn a written script into spoken audio, making it practical for wedding vows, memorial tributes, travel stories, and personal documentaries. Music can also be selected automatically, while audio ducking lowers the background track when narration begins.
Creative controls remain available for users who want more personality. Cinematic typography, custom backgrounds, stickers, chroma-key elements, fairy-dust particles, borders, Polaroid-style frames, and Ken Burns motion can be combined to give a project a distinct visual character.
The platform also supports cloud-authoritative saving and a 50-step undo and redo history, giving users room to experiment without worrying about permanently losing earlier edits.

Start by creating a new project and selecting the type of story you want to make, such as a wedding, memorial, birthday, travel project, or business presentation. Add your photos and videos, then decide whether you want the AI to compose the project or prefer to work manually.
If you have a story or script, add it to the project. The AI can analyze the text, identify themes and tone, and suggest a scene structure. It can then match relevant photographs to the important moments while using additional images to maintain a natural rhythm.
Next, choose your music or allow the system to select music for the project. If narration is needed, provide a script and select a suitable voice. The system can generate the narration and synchronize it with the visual sequence.
Finally, review the project in the editor. Adjust scenes, timing, effects, borders, backgrounds, or audio where necessary. When everything looks right, preview the complete film and export it at the resolution available on your plan.
Traditional video editors generally provide extensive manual control, but they can require considerably more time to arrange photographs, determine scene durations, create transitions, and synchronize audio. The main advantage of this platform is that many of those decisions can be handled automatically before the user begins fine-tuning the result.
Compared with simpler online slideshow makers, the combination of AI script analysis, photo understanding, face-aware cropping, automatic scene composition, narration, and cinematic effects gives it a more story-oriented workflow.
It is not necessarily the ideal choice for every professional editing task. Someone producing a complex commercial video with extensive frame-by-frame editing may still prefer a dedicated professional editor. For memory-driven slideshows and photo-based storytelling, however, the automated approach can save a considerable amount of time.
